A collaborative discussion for practices and those from the built environment on navigating the Building Safety Act in real-world settings
About this Event

The Building Safety Act continues to reshape responsibilities across our sector so join us for a collaborative, practitioner-led discussion on what the act means in practice, how organisations are responding, and what we’ve learned as an industry so far. This session brings together professionals to share real-world experiences and hear from peers who are actively navigating the Act’s requirements.

This event brings practitioners together to explore:

  • Where we’ve come from and how the industry has adapted
  • What we’ve learned in implementing new processes
  • How we see responsibilities evolving, both now and in the near future


During the event, we will also explore four focused presentation topics:

HRB to Domestic: Building Safety and Building Control Update

Presented by Tony Harvey-Soanes (Vantage Building Control), and Paul Hilsden (RH Building Consultancy)
An overview of the latest developments affecting both Higher-Risk Buildings and domestic projects, with insight into current Building Control approaches.


Traditional vs Design & Build: Understanding the Differences Under the Act

Presented by Aoife O’Gorman(BCR Infinity),and Mark Hart (Barnes Construction)
A comparison of procurement routes and how responsibilities, risk, and compliance obligations shift under each model.


Compliance Tracking: What Is Needed and When

Presented by David Hills (rhp) and RIBA
A practical look at how to structure compliance tracking to meet the Act’s requirements, with a specific focus on non-higher-risk buildings (non-HRBs), from early project stages through to handover.


Clients: When to Appoint and How to Provide the Best Consultant Advice

Presented by Nicky Silvey (Potter Raper) and RIBA
Guidance on client responsibilities, the timing of appointments, and delivering effective, informed consultant support throughout a project.
